Guinea pig bedding tips for newbies
Guinea pigs need a comfortable bed to sleep in just as you do, so it is important to pick the right kind of bedding for your pet. When you are shopping for guinea pig bedding it is important to remember that you cannot simply use any old materials as guinea pig bedding.
You need to take special care not to offer your guinea pig anything that could be dangerous. That means no possibly toxic bedding and nothing that could strangle or choke your pet.

Other guinea pig bedding options include wood shavings, paper and hay.
Wood shavings are a popular guinea pig bedding choice. Pine and aspen wood shavings are the best for your pig. However, this can cause allergic reactions in some guineas so watch your pet’s reaction to any bedding very carefully. Shredded paper bedding is popular as it is dust free and makes a soft bed for your guinea pig. It is important to note that shredded paper used as guinea pig bedding must not have any ink on it as this can be highly toxic.
Hay is the next option and this is popular as your guinea pig can munch on it in bed. Hay bedding needs to be changed each day.
